You Need A Budget (YNAB) You Need A Budget, also known as YNAB is an in-depth budgeting app that works on 4 key premises: Give Every Dollar a Job, Embrace Your True Expenses, Roll with the Punches, and Age Your Money. Quicken is another budget app that will allow you to view all of your finances in one place. You will have the ability to link your bank accounts, investment portfolios, retirement accounts, and credit cards to Quicken.
